Abstract
A new method for the synthesis of 7H-pyrido[1, 2, 3-de][1, 4]benzoxazine derivatives was developed. The method is characterized by the intramolecular cyclization of 1-(1-hydroxyprop-2-yl)-8-fluoro-4-quinolones which are prepared in three or four steps from ethyl 2, 3, 4, 5-tetrafluoro-benzoylacetate. As an application of this method, ofloxacin, an antibacterial agent, was synthesized.
